I am trying to figure out what all the BSC Christmas books were, preferably ones where Christmas was more than just a background story line (like Here Come the Bridesmaids).
I read through 90, back in the day, and have picked up a handful of later ones throughout the years, but am not as familiar with their story lines as the early ones.
So far on my list I have:
- Snowbound (not really, but I love that book so I include it!) - Beware, Baby-sitters (background Christmas, very super good book) - Baby-sitters Christmas Chiller - Secret Santa
Looking at the title list, I have also Mallory's Christmas Wish Happy Holidays, Jessi; The Secret Life of MA Spier;
Are there more than that?? Didn't Get Well Soon, Mallory take place around Thanksgiving/Christmas?
